引言
随着科技的发展,编程已成为现代社会不可或缺的技能之一。对于有志于投身编程领域的年轻人来说,升学规划显得尤为重要。本文将为您揭秘编程未来之路,提供一份升学规划全攻略,帮助您顺利成为科技新星。
一、了解编程领域
1.1 编程的定义
编程,即编写程序,是指用计算机语言告诉计算机如何执行任务的过程。它涉及算法设计、数据结构、编程语言等多个方面。
1.2 编程领域的分类
编程领域主要分为以下几个方向:
- 前端开发:负责网页界面设计和实现,如HTML、CSS、JavaScript等。
- 后端开发:负责服务器、数据库等方面的开发,如Java、Python、PHP等。
- 移动应用开发:负责手机应用的开发,如Android、iOS等。
- 游戏开发:负责游戏设计、编程和调试,如Unity、Cocos2d-x等。
- 人工智能与大数据:涉及机器学习、深度学习、数据分析等领域。
二、升学规划
2.1 选择合适的学校和专业
在选择学校和专业时,应考虑以下因素:
- 学校声誉:选择知名大学或专业院校,有利于就业和发展。
- 专业实力:了解学校在相关领域的教学和研究实力。
- 课程设置:选择课程设置合理、与市场需求相符的专业。
2.2 编程语言学习
在大学阶段,以下编程语言是必备的:
- Python:广泛应用于人工智能、数据分析等领域。
- Java:适用于企业级应用开发。
- JavaScript:用于前端开发。
- C/C++:基础编程语言,适用于系统级开发。
2.3 实践经验积累
- 课程项目:积极参与课程项目,锻炼编程能力。
- 实习经历:争取在知名企业实习,了解行业动态。
- 开源项目:参与开源项目,提升团队协作能力和解决问题的能力。
2.4 考取相关证书
- 计算机等级考试:如CET-4、CET-6等。
- 专业证书:如Oracle Certified Professional、Microsoft Certified Professional等。
三、职业发展
3.1 入职准备
- 简历制作:突出编程技能和项目经验。
- 面试技巧:掌握面试技巧,如自我介绍、技术面试等。
3.2 职业规划
- 初级工程师:积累工作经验,提升技术水平。
- 中级工程师:担任技术团队负责人,负责项目开发。
- 高级工程师:成为技术专家,参与技术决策。
四、结语
编程未来之路充满机遇和挑战。通过合理的升学规划,不断提升自身能力,您将一跃成为科技新星。祝您在编程领域取得优异成绩!